1. Inconsistent Cooling Performance

One of the most common complaints from Hitachi refrigerator owners is poor or inconsistent cooling. This can affect both the fridge and freezer compartments, leading to spoiled food and fluctuating temperatures.

Causes:

  • Dusty or clogged condenser coils that reduce heat dissipation
  • Malfunctioning thermostat failing to regulate temperatures accurately
  • Low refrigerant levels that impair cooling efficiency
  • Compressor wear or failure

Impact:
Food items spoil quickly, ice cream melts, and drinks may become warm. Energy bills rise as the appliance overworks to maintain the desired temperature.

Solution:
Professional Hitachi Fridge & Refrigerator Repair Abu Hail technicians thoroughly clean condenser coils, test and adjust thermostats, refill refrigerant if needed, and repair or replace the compressor. These steps restore uniform cooling and improve energy efficiency.

2. Frost or Ice Accumulation

Excessive frost or ice buildup in the freezer or fridge compartment can disrupt appliance performance and reduce storage space.

Causes:

  • Faulty defrost heater or timer preventing proper melting cycles
  • Damaged or worn door gaskets allowing humid air inside
  • Blocked vents reducing airflow

Impact:
Ice buildup limits usable space, causes uneven cooling, and makes accessing drawers or shelves difficult. Over time, frost can affect the appliance’s overall efficiency.

Solution:
Experts inspect the defrost system, repair or replace faulty heaters and timers, and replace damaged door seals. Proper airflow is restored, keeping compartments frost-free and efficient.

3. Water Leakage Problems

Leaks from your Hitachi fridge can be more than an inconvenience—they may cause property damage.

Causes:

  • Blocked or damaged drain lines preventing proper condensation flow
  • Cracked water supply hoses or loose connections
  • Faulty internal pans or trays

Impact:
Leaks can damage kitchen flooring, cabinets, and surrounding areas. Mold and mildew may develop, and electrical hazards increase due to water exposure.

Solution:
Technicians inspect the drainage system, repair or replace pipes and hoses, and ensure all internal pans are intact. A thorough check prevents recurring leaks and protects your home from water damage.

4. Strange or Loud Noises

Unusual sounds from your fridge often indicate mechanical or electrical stress that should not be ignored.

Causes:

  • Worn or failing fan motors
  • Loose internal components vibrating during operation
  • Aging or damaged compressor creating rattling or humming noises

Impact:
Persistent noise disrupts the household environment and may indicate impending mechanical failure. Ignoring these signs can result in more extensive and expensive repairs.

Solution:
Certified Hitachi technicians perform a detailed inspection to locate the source of the noise. They repair or replace faulty motors, fans, or internal components, restoring quiet and smooth operation.

5. Refrigerator Not Powering On

A refrigerator that won’t start is a critical problem, as it risks rapid food spoilage.

Causes:

  • Power supply issues, including tripped breakers or blown fuses
  • Faulty control boards that regulate appliance functions
  • Damaged wiring or electrical connections

Impact:
Without power, cooling stops completely, creating a risk of food loss. This disruption can affect daily routines and household convenience.

Solution:
Professional Hitachi Fridge & Refrigerator Repair Abu Hail technicians diagnose electrical faults safely. They repair or replace control boards, test circuits, and ensure proper power supply, restoring reliable functionality.

Why Hitachi Refrigerators Display Error Codes

Error codes serve as early warning signals. When the fridge detects irregularities in sensors, fans, compressors, or other components, it triggers a code to alert the user. Ignoring these warnings can escalate minor faults into serious mechanical or electrical failures, leading to food spoilage, water damage, and higher energy bills.

Common causes of error codes include:

  • Sensor Failures: Temperature or defrost sensors may misread the internal environment.
  • Cooling System Malfunctions: Compressor issues or refrigerant problems may disrupt cooling.
  • Fan or Airflow Problems: Evaporator or condenser fan malfunctions can cause uneven cooling.
  • Defrost Cycle Errors: A broken defrost heater or timer can result in frost buildup.
  • Electrical or Control Board Issues: Wiring faults or damaged circuit boards may prevent proper operation.

Preventive Maintenance Tips for Hitachi Refrigerators

Regular maintenance prevents many common issues:

  • Clean condenser coils regularly for efficient cooling
  • Check door seals and gaskets to avoid cold air loss
  • Inspect water lines and ice makers for leaks
  • Avoid overloading to maintain proper airflow
  • Schedule annual professional service to detect minor issues early

Simple checks can prevent major problems and improve energy efficiency.

4. Can I reset my fridge after an error code?
Temporary resets may sometimes clear minor glitches, but they rarely solve underlying problems. Recurrent error codes signal a component or sensor issue that requires professional inspection. Ignoring them can worsen the fault, increase energy consumption, and risk food spoilage. It’s always safer to have a certified technician diagnose the cause.

5. Is repairing an old fridge worth it?
Repairing a fridge is worthwhile if major components such as the compressor, control board, or fans are still functional. Professional service can extend the appliance’s life and save the cost of early replacement. However, if multiple critical parts are failing, replacement may be more cost-effective.
